THE PERKS OF BEING A WALLFLOWER
This book “The Perks of being a Wallflower” by Stephen Chbosky is about a fifteen year old boy named Charlie, who is processing the suicide of his friend, Michael. To relax the fear and anxiety of starting high school alone, Charlie starts writing letters to a stranger. At school his English teacher, Bill, became his friend and mentor. He also overcomes his shyness and get to know a classmate, Patrick, who, along with his step-sister Sam, become two of Charlie's BFFs. During the school year, Charlie has his first date and his first kiss, he deals with bullies, he experiments with drugs and drinking, and he makes friends, loses them and after gains them back. Charlie has a stable home life. Unfortunately, a disturbing family secret that Charlie has repressed for his entire life surfaces at the end of the school year. Charlie has a severe mental breakdown and ends up hospitalized. Charlie's final letter closes with feelings of hope: getting released from the hospital, forgiving his aunt Helen for what she did to him, finding new friends during sophomore year, and trying his best not to be a wallflower. Charlie hopes to get out of his head and into the real world.
